Abstract

The invention relates to a mechanical vertical-type internal broaching machine, which comprises a base, machine bodies, slide carriages, and driving mechanisms used for driving the slide carriages to vertically move, wherein the machine bodies comprise a first machine body and a second machine body which are arranged at an interval on the base and are parallel to each other; the slide carriages respectively comprise a first slide carriage and a second slide carriage which are respectively positioned on two opposite surfaces of the first machine body and the second machine body; the driving mechanisms respectively comprise a first driving mechanism and a second driving mechanism which are respectively used for driving the first slide carriage and the second slide carriage to synchronously move; and a workbench is fixed between the first slide carriage and the second slide carriage. The mechanical vertical-type internal broaching machine provided by the invention adopts the structures of double machine bodies and double driving mechanisms to synchronously drive the two slide carriages to slide, thereby reducing the length of the slide carriages, and has the advantages of simpleness in manufacture, low cost, environment friendliness, small occupied space, easiness in trouble shooting, high production efficiency and stable broaching.

Technical field
The present invention relates to a kind of Metal Cutting Machine Tool, particularly relate to a kind of mechanical type vertical internal broaching machine.
Background technology
Fast development and raising and control technology rapid progress along with transmission parts manufacture level in China's machinery manufacturing industry, China's machine-tool industry has been obtained development at full speed equally, but also rest on six as the important a part broaching machine in lathe series, the seventies level, conventional hydraulic drive broaching machine and are occupying the whole of broaching machine market almost.The vertical internal broaching machine that uses at present generally includes a base, a lathe bed on base, and a slide carriage, and hydraulic drive mechanism, hydraulic drive mechanism drives main cargo chute and moves up and down, and then utilizes broaching tool on main cargo chute to the workpiece motion of broaching.As disclosed in Chinese patent CN201082483Y a kind of " vertical internal broaching machine " comprises vertical frame, broaching tool, main hydraulic transmission assembly, also comprise pneumatic clamping mechanism, griffe portable plate, griffe the parts such as cylinder.Such vertical internal broaching machine is in order to guarantee the machining accuracy of part, usually the size of main cargo chute is larger, especially in the vertical internal broaching machine structure of two hydraulic oil cylinder driving main cargo chutes, synchronous in order to guarantee twin-tub, main cargo chute is made into very long, thereby cause the main cargo chute processing difficulties, the shortcomings such as manufacturing cost height.
And in fluid pressure drive device, hydraulic system is the mechanical electronic hydraulic integrated system of a complexity, each subsystem is realized systemic-function with itself work and mutual cooperation when normal condition, complexity due to system architecture and operation principle, in case system breaks down, often be difficult to determine rapidly and accurately system failure source, the jitter problem of hydraulic pressure particularly, it is a long-term insoluble problem in the broaching machine product always, in the solution process, the technical staff adopts empirical method usually, successively exclusive method is analyzed, and causes that diagnosis speed is slow, efficient is low.And in the broaching process, broaching speed is slow, production efficiency is low, not environmental protection, and floor space is large.

The specific embodiment
Embodiment is described in further detail the present invention below in conjunction with accompanying drawing.
Mechanical vertical-type internal broaching machine of the present invention as shown in Figure 1, 2, comprises base 1, interval and be set in parallel in the first lathe bed 11 and the second lathe bed 12 on base 1, and described the first lathe bed 11 and the second lathe bed 12 vertically are arranged on base 1.Vertically be provided with respectively ball wire bar pair 6 on described the first lathe bed 11 and two of the second lathe bed 12 relative faces, the guide rail 5 that extends in the same way with ball wire bar pair 6 in ball wire bar pair 6 both sides or a side, be arranged on the first slide carriage 31 and the second slide carriage 32 that are connected and fixed respectively on the nut of described ball wire bar pair, described the first slide carriage 31 and the second slide carriage 32 match with guide rail 5 respectively and move up and down along guide rail 5 under the drive of ball wire bar pair 6.
Be respectively equipped with the first driving mechanism 41 and the second driving mechanism 42 on described the first lathe bed 11 and the second lathe bed 12, described the first driving mechanism 41 and the second driving mechanism 42 drive respectively this first slide carriage 31 and the second slide carriage 32 moves up and down along guide rail 5 respectively, and this first slide carriage 31 and the second slide carriage 32 keep being synchronized with the movement up and down under the driving of the first driving mechanism 41 and the second driving mechanism 42.
Be fixed with workbench 2 between the first slide carriage 31 and the second slide carriage 32, workbench 2 can move up and down along two lathe beds under the drive of the first slide carriage 31 and the second slide carriage 32 reposefully.Have the fixedly collet body seat 21 of broaching tool 7 bottoms on the base 1 of workbench 2 belows, be installed with the main collet body 22 that matches with the bottom of broaching tool on this collet body seat 21, be used for placing the workpiece of broaching on workbench 2.Broaching tool 7 just is fixed between the first lathe bed 11 and the second lathe bed 12, fixedly stands on the top of workbench 2 and can be passed down through workbench 2 to be fixed on collet body 22.
Also be provided with the broach feeding mechanism 8 that matches with broaching tool 7 tops between this first lathe bed 11 and the second lathe bed 12.This broaching tool submits the auxiliary roll ballscrew pair 83 that mechanism 8 comprises vertical setting, be fixed on the auxiliary collet body 81 that matches with broaching tool 7 tops is set downwards on the nut of described auxiliary roll ballscrew pair 83, this knife lifting and delivering mechanism 8 comprises that also an auxiliary drive mechanism 82 is used for driving auxiliary roll ballscrew secondary 83 and moves this auxiliary collet body 81 is moved up and down with auxiliary roll ballscrew pair 83.
the course of work of this vertical internal broaching machine is as follows: workpiece is arranged on workbench 2, auxiliary collet body 81 in knife lifting and delivering mechanism 8 clamps the top of broaching tool 7, and down send cutter by auxiliary driving mechanism 82 drivings, stop after sending cutter to put in place sliding, at this moment, the bottom of main collet body 22 locking broaching tools 7, auxiliary collet body 81 unclamps the top of broaching tool 7, fixedly mount two lathe beds 11, the first driving mechanism 41 on 12 and the second driving mechanism 42 drive simultaneously with the ball wire bar pair 6 that coordinates separately and drive nut and slide carriage 31, 32 up slide, workpiece on 7 pairs of workbench 2 of broaching tool is broached simultaneously.When being about to complete the broaching motion, knife lifting and delivering mechanism 8 drives up motion by auxiliary driving mechanism 82, breaks away from broaching tool 7 tops, and after broaching put in place, workbench 2 was released workpiece.The first and second driving mechanisms 41,42 drive simultaneously with the main ball wire bar pair 6 that coordinates separately and drive nuts and slide carriage 31,32 toward lower slider, drive simultaneously workbench 2 down slidings.When being about to complete the return motion, knife lifting and delivering mechanism 8 drives down motion by auxiliary driving mechanism 82, motion puts rear auxiliary collet body 81 in place with broaching tool 7 top lockings, main collet body 22 bottom of unclamping broaching tool 7 simultaneously, knife lifting and delivering mechanism 8 drives up motion by auxiliary driving mechanism 72, to carry the top that is positioned at workbench 2 on broaching tool 7, the workpiece on desirable lower table 2, complete whole actuation cycle at this moment.
Described the first driving mechanism and the second driving mechanism are servo-actuating device, such as driving mechanisms such as servomotors.The present invention drives simultaneously the slide carriage drive by two servo-actuating devices and is fixed in two workbench between lathe bed due to two lathe beds being housed on base, has effectively solved the jiggly phenomenon of broaching.
The present invention adopts two slide carriages of double-mechanical driven in synchronism to slide, and the length of each slide carriage just can be arranged to very short, has reduced the length of slide carriage, thereby has reduced manufacturing, processing cost.
The present invention is realized the drive connection of each mechanical drive train by numerical control program, utilize the driven by servomotor screw mandrel to drive main cargo chute and move up and down, and has reduced the energy consumption in the broaching process.Simultaneously, cancelled hydraulic drive mechanism, effectively reduced hydraulic fluid leak, reduced product cost and eliminated hydraulic system fault.The floor space of lathe and the use of hydraulic oil have been reduced.The fault of this mechanical vertical-type internal broaching machine is got rid of easily, production efficiency is high, broaching is stable.
